Unpacking Climate Policy

While working on my Master of Public Administration in Environmental Policy at the University of Washington, I developed a five-step guide for journalists covering climate policy. By adapting existing empirical frameworks used by public administrators and social scientists, this guide empowers reporters to navigate the complexities of climate action, fostering greater public understanding and accountability. This guide was supported by a National Science Foundation Traineeship fostered through UW's EarthLab and Future Rivers program, with additional support from the Solutions Journalism Network through feedback and publication.
